Understanding Celsius and Fahrenheit

Temperature is a physical quantity that measures the degree of hotness or coldness of an object or environment. It is an essential aspect of our daily lives and is measured using different temperature scales. Two of the most common temperature scales used around the world are Celsius and Fahrenheit.

Celsius, also known as centigrade, is a metric temperature scale that was developed by Swedish astronomer Anders Celsius in 1742. It is based on the freezing and boiling points of water, with 0°C as the freezing point and 100°C as the boiling point at standard atmospheric pressure.

Fahrenheit, on the other hand, is a temperature scale invented by German physicist Daniel Gabriel Fahrenheit in 1724. It is based on a system where 32°F is the freezing point of water, and 212°F is the boiling point at standard atmospheric pressure.

Converting 8°C to °F

If you need to convert 8°C to °F, you can use a simple formula that involves multiplying the Celsius temperature by 1.8 and then adding 32.

Convert 8 Celsius To Fahrenheit

Therefore, to convert 8°C to °F, you need to multiply 8 by 1.8, which gives you 14.4. Then you add 32 to 14.4, which gives you the final answer of 46.4°F.
